Transaction 31febd58032b56f2018deb93aac3580b6147b4e3f8af4f6358515aaeb7c7a0d5
1 Input
1 Output
-
31febd58032b56f2018deb93aac3580b6147b4e3f8af4f6358515aaeb7c7a0d5:0
- value
- 7058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b41f2463ece84a14d6449a45ab2ba4e122c6efab OP_EQUAL
- address
- 3J7QrsHHeZYff7d2wBVrVjfdtUvevBofc5